Warning Signs You Need Industrial Dehumidification

Catching these signs early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ent more extensive damage down the line. Don’t ignore the warning signs, act fast to protect your property and your wallet.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ent odors are a sign that moisture is present in your property. If you notice musty smells, especially in areas prone to dampness like basements or crawl spaces, it’s time to call in the professionals.

Water Stains or Warping on Walls or Floors

Water damage can cause unsightly stains or warping on your walls or floors. If you notice any discoloration or distortion, it’s a sign that moisture is seeping into your property.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per is a sign that moisture is behind the surface, causing the paint or paper to separate from the wall.

Mold or Mildew Growth

Mold or mildew growth is a serious sign of moisture accumulation. If you notice any black spots or greenish patches on your walls, floors, or ceilings, it’s time to take action.

Increased Humidity Levels

High humidity levels can cause a range of problems, from musty odors to structural damage. If you notice that your property feels damp or humid, it’s a sign that moisture is present.

Unusual Sounds or Creaks

Unusual sounds or creaks can be a sign that moisture is causing your property’s structure to shift or settle. If you notice any strange noises, it’s time to investigate further.

Industrial Dehumidification v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spill in a well-ventilated area Yes No DIY equipment and techniques can handle small spills effectively.
Large water flood in a basement or crawl space No Yes Professional equipment and expertise are needed to extract moisture and prevent further damage.
Musty odors in a single room Yes No DIY air purifiers and dehumidifiers can handle small-scale issues.
Water damage affecting multiple rooms or levels No Yes Professional assessment and equipment are necessary to tackle widespread moisture issues.
Structural damage or warping from water No Yes Professional expertise is required to assess and repair structural damage.
High humidity levels in a large commercial space No Yes Professional-grade equipment and techniques are needed to tackle large-scale humidity issues.

Industrial Dehumidification Cost in Edmonds, WA

The cost of Industrial Dehumidification can vary depending on the severity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Edmonds, WA. These estimates are based on real-world scenarios and can give you a rough idea of what to expect.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Emergency Response and Assessment $500 – $2,500 Severity of issue, size of affected area, and local conditions.
Equipment Rental and Installation $1,000 – $5,000 Type and quantity of equipment needed, complexity of installation.
Moisture Extraction and Removal $2,000 – $10,000 Size of affected area, severity of moisture accumulation, and equipment costs.
Drying and Monitoring $1,500 – $6,000 Size of affected area, severity of moisture accumulation, and equipment costs.
Final Inspection and Cleanup $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, complexity of cleanup, and equipment costs.
Repair and Restoration $5,000 – $20,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and materials needed for repair.
